. I'm an in-home provider in my 5th year. I generally don't take that much time off; the first four years of doing this job, I didn't take any paid days off other than holidays. My families got five "free" days. Last year I started making some changes and as new families came in, I took some paid time off for me, and then with new contracts this year, I intergrated that into the contracts of my existing families as well. Basically, they now get ten days, and I get ten days, plus the holidays (which all of my families have pd holidays at their jobs too).
